Whitman is a passenger rail station on the MBTA Commuter Rail Plymouth/Kingston Line, located off South Avenue (MA 27) in Whitman, Massachusetts. Parking is available on the south side of South Avenue on both sides of the tracks.

The station opened along with the rest of the Old Colony Lines on September 26, 1997.

The station consists of a single side platform serving a single track

A former roundhouse uncovered during construction was turned into a small park
